I have a local customer who wants the hinges with the springs on his 1971 Challenger chromed, has any one on here done that or know a good chrome shop who will? help

I had some done. But the spring can rust right away. as they are only polished and plated closed. As and such are viewed as spread open. I just wanted to toss that out there.
I made 3 sets of rods up. Just bent simple stock to place where the springs go. light open halfway and fully open.
I would also put a few coats of car paint type wax on the hinges as well to prevent rust as well as they do rub when used.

They are going to look like crap and you'll be held responsible !. There's just no way to properly polish hood hinges without complete disassembly and polishing and plating each individual piece - that means drilling all the rivets out. And then what do you reassemble them with ?!?! Hand them back and tell him he's on his own on that one !

I had an nos set done in the 80s, still look perfect, they were dipped in the open position. Chrome shop would not polish them unless they were disassembled, too many employees hurt he said. I just locked the chuck on my da and polished them till they looked like chrome with 320 white 3m paper. I think restorick rebuilds them, maybe he could have them done for you? It was $50 cash back then.
